The Head of HR serves as a key member of the business unit’s leadership team, responsible
for developing and executing a high-impact people strategy that supports the long-term
vision of the unit. This role provides strategic direction and oversight for all human capital
initiatives within the business unit, fostering a culture of performance, innovation, and
accountability.
The ideal candidate will be a forward-thinking HR leader who combines strategic vision with
hands-on execution, capable of aligning people’s capabilities with the business unit’s goals.
- Define and execute a comprehensive HR strategy aligned with the business unit’s overall objectives and growth agenda.
- Lead organizational design, workforce planning, and talent architecture to ensure optimal structures for success.
- Serve as a trusted advisor to the Business Unit Head and senior management on organizational effectiveness, leadership succession, and people risk.
- Drive cultural initiatives that support high performance, accountability, and agility within the business unit.
- Build strong leadership pipelines through strategic talent development, succession planning, and coaching.
- Lead change management strategies during key transitions such as expansions or restructuring.
- Develop and implement HR governance frameworks, policies, and processes tailored to the business unit, ensuring compliance with local laws and alignment with corporate standards.
- Monitor and mitigate people-related risks, including regulatory, reputational, and operational risks.
- Ensure ethical standards, employee relations practices, and grievance mechanisms are effectively implemented.
- Establish an employer brand strategy that positions the business unit as a top employer in its sector.
- Oversee recruitment and strategic talent acquisition programs for the business unit.
- Build capability frameworks that support innovation, digital transformation, and cross-functional agility.
- Design and implement compensation, benefits, and incentive programs that drive business performance.
- Promote a performance-driven culture through robust KPIs and reward mechanisms that align with unit objectives.
- Benchmark reward strategies to ensure competitiveness in the market.
- Drive digital HR initiatives within the business unit, including HR systems implementation and process automation.
- Use people analytics to provide insights and guide strategic decisions around workforce trends, engagement, and productivity.

What We Do
CIG Motors is an original equipment manufacturer (OEM) and the exclusive representative and distributor for leading Chinese automotive brands in Nigeria, offering a wide range of automobiles.
